Responsibilities
Serves as the responsible physician and health authority required
by national standards. Provides overall supervision for clinical
services for the site to ensure appropriate delivery of on site and
off site necessary medical care. While in charge of a site, this
level of position does not manage regular physicians. Full time 40
hours a week or 20 hours a week.

- Documentation must be completed between 48 to 72 hours of any
visit (preferably same day). Ensures Medical Record documentation
is in SOAP format, problem oriented and corresponds to the
therapeutic order. Ensures all documentation is timed, legible and
signed. Ensures all verbal or telephone orders are countersigned
within seventy-two (72) hours.
- All test results ordered in facility must to be reviewed within
72 hours.
